-
Notifications
You must be signed in to change notification settings - Fork 25
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[Context Manager ] Ability to import/export an application context #584
Comments
having a directory in the datadir with maps/contexts made available by mapstore would also allow easily to migrate them from instance to instance, instead of having to export from the db via an api/import in another platform. But yes, having an import/export button in the context manager saving a json file would be nice. |
The implementation expects to improve the context manager UI to allow an export of each single context from the context card and provide a generic import button (the design aspects will be reviewed again before the implementation if needed). The context will be imported as it was exported. |
i'm not 100% sure that's the intent, to clarify:
sure, one could enforce relative urls (eg
@catmorales sounds right ? |
Mock added to MS issue |
…context * commit 'bafa39ef26882233c009a2a5424ccc1f062de7ba': georchestra#584 - Feature grid enabled in context-creator (georchestra#630)
Description
Ability to import/export an application context from the context manager UI
The base URL can be changed in the import and in the export,
Import specific : A control on the layers's, plugins and roles must be done and a message displayed if some components are missing in the destiny platform.
Customized configurations of the plugins should be export too.
In fact the entire context configuration which is stored in the database must be exported
Functionnality just for administrators.
Use case :
We have a test geOrchestra's instance (portail-test.sig.rennesmetropole.fr) and a production geOrchestra's instance (portail.sig.rennesmetropole.fr). Both have the same components (geoserver, mapstore,...) and the same layers published.
When an application context is Ok in the test platform, we need to deploy it in the production platform, we need a tool to do it from the UI.
Note
Related MS issue geosolutions-it/MapStore2#9248
The text was updated successfully, but these errors were encountered: